If you have something like WEB1.company.com and WEB2.company.com you have :
* To create to 2 web publishing rules on ISA, ... one per name
* Add the right parameters on IIS, I mean create the 2 web site, and set
the right parmeters on the host header name.
On IIS, woth sites can listen on the same port thanks to the host header
name.
If you plan to use HTTPS, add 1 certificate for each web site on IIS, and
add only 1 on ISA, but the name has to be *.company.com in order to handle
more than 1 site.
